package bootstrap
import (
"github.com/pelletier/go-toml/v2"
)
func NewBottlerocketConfig(userdata *string) (*BottlerocketConfig, error) {
c := &BottlerocketConfig{}
if userdata == nil {
return c, nil
}
if err := c.UnmarshalTOML([]byte(*userdata)); err != nil {
return c, err
}
return c, nil
}
// BottlerocketConfig is the root of the bottlerocket config, see more here https://github.com/bottlerocket-os/bottlerocket#using-user-data
type BottlerocketConfig struct {
SettingsRaw map[string]interface{} `toml:"settings"`
Settings BottlerocketSettings `toml:"-"`
}
// BottlerocketSettings is a subset of all configuration in https://github.com/bottlerocket-os/bottlerocket/blob/develop/sources/models/src/aws-k8s-1.22/mod.rs
// These settings apply across all K8s versions that karpenter supports.
type BottlerocketSettings struct {
Kubernetes BottlerocketKubernetes `toml:"kubernetes"`
}
// BottlerocketKubernetes is k8s specific configuration for bottlerocket api
type BottlerocketKubernetes struct {
APIServer *string `toml:"api-server"`
ClusterCertificate *string `toml:"cluster-certificate"`
ClusterName *string `toml:"cluster-name"`
ClusterDNSIP *string `toml:"cluster-dns-ip,omitempty"`
NodeLabels map[string]string `toml:"node-labels,omitempty"`
NodeTaints map[string][]string `toml:"node-taints,omitempty"`
MaxPods *int `toml:"max-pods,omitempty"`
StaticPods map[string]BottlerocketStaticPod `toml:"static-pods,omitempty"`
EvictionHard map[string]string `toml:"eviction-hard,omitempty"`
KubeReserved map[string]string `toml:"kube-reserved,omitempty"`
SystemReserved map[string]string `toml:"system-reserved,omitempty"`
AllowedUnsafeSysctls []string `toml:"allowed-unsafe-sysctls,omitempty"`
ServerTLSBootstrap *bool `toml:"server-tls-bootstrap,omitempty"`
RegistryQPS *int `toml:"registry-qps,omitempty"`
RegistryBurst *int `toml:"registry-burst,omitempty"`
EventQPS *int `toml:"event-qps,omitempty"`
EventBurst *int `toml:"event-burst,omitempty"`
KubeAPIQPS *int `toml:"kube-api-qps,omitempty"`
KubeAPIBurst *int `toml:"kube-api-burst,omitempty"`
ContainerLogMaxSize *string `toml:"container-log-max-size,omitempty"`
ContainerLogMaxFiles *int `toml:"container-log-max-files,omitempty"`
CPUManagerPolicy *string `toml:"cpu-manager-policy,omitempty"`
CPUManagerReconcilePeriod *string `toml:"cpu-manager-reconcile-period,omitempty"`
TopologyManagerScope *string `toml:"topology-manager-scope,omitempty"`
ImageGCLowThresholdPercent *int32 `toml:"image-gc-high-threshold-percent,omitempty"`
ImageGCHighThresholdPercent *int32 `toml:"image-gc-low-threshold-percent,omitempty"`
}
type BottlerocketStaticPod struct {
Enabled *bool `toml:"enabled,omitempty"`
Manifest *string `toml:"manifest,omitempty"`
}
func (c *BottlerocketConfig) UnmarshalTOML(data []byte) error {
// unmarshal known settings
s := struct {
Settings BottlerocketSettings `toml:"settings"`
}{}
if err := toml.Unmarshal(data, &s); err != nil {
return err
}
// unmarshal untyped settings
if err := toml.Unmarshal(data, c); err != nil {
return err
}
c.Settings = s.Settings
return nil
}
func (c *BottlerocketConfig) MarshalTOML() ([]byte, error) {
if c.SettingsRaw == nil {
c.SettingsRaw = map[string]interface{}{}
}
c.SettingsRaw["kubernetes"] = c.Settings.Kubernetes
return toml.Marshal(c)
}
